What is the L9369-TR?
The L9369-TR is an automotive-grade H-bridge driver IC from STMicroelectronics, specifically designed for electric parking braking (EPB) systems. It integrates two H-bridge driver stages to drive 8 external FETs for rear wheel brake actuators, supporting both cable-puller and Motor Gear Unit (MGU) configurations. According to the ST datasheet, it operates from 5.5 V to 28 V and provides a peak output current of 8.5 A per H-bridge.

Design Notes

The L9369-TR in the 64-LQFP package has a thermal resistance of 25 C/W. For continuous high-current operation, ensure adequate copper area on the PCB for heat dissipation. A large ground plane and thermal vias are recommended to keep the junction temperature within safe limits. Place the L9369-TR close to the motor connectors to minimize trace inductance and resistance. Use wide, short traces for high-current paths (H-bridge outputs) to reduce voltage drops and heat generation. Decouple the VCC pin with a 100 nF ceramic capacitor and a 10 uF electrolytic capacitor near the IC. Ensure the SPI lines are routed away from high-current traces to avoid noise coupling.

Do not exceed the absolute maximum supply voltage of 28 V. Ensure the SPI interface is properly configured to enable fault reporting and diagnostic functions. The current sense amplifier outputs should be connected to the ADC inputs of the microcontroller with appropriate filtering to avoid noise. Verify the external FETs are properly sized for the peak current and have adequate gate drive voltage.
